Next attraction is the Hermitage. All photos are original and taken by me.
This pavilion in the Baroque style. Located in the Catherine Park in Tsarskoye Selo (town of Pushkin)

The pavilion was intended for a narrow circle of courtiers. This is the place for entertainment.

This octagonal pavilion has two floors. Located on an artificial island. To get to the island is just across the bridge over the moat.


The Hermitage pavilion was erected in the years 1743-1753. Are the architects A. V. Kvasov, S. I. Chevakinsky. Final luxury design belongs to the great master Bartolomeo Rastrelli.

Decorative columns, moldings, garlands - here in large numbers. Balcony with openwork lattice with the initials of the Empress Catherine ... All of this evidence belong to the Royal personage.




The interiors amaze with luxury and splendor. It mirrors in gilt frames. Carved furniture. A lot of paintings on mythological subjects. Elements of mythology are present on the outer design of the pavilion.
